STATISTICS AND DATA COMMITTEE WRAPPED UP IT TRAINING AT ALIU MAHAMA STADIUM

The Data and Statistics Committee of the Northern Regional Football Association wrapped up the IT training exercise for clubs with Tamale Metro and Sagnarigu Municipal. Over 60 people participated in the training. The essence of the IT Training is to equip clubs’ IT officers with the requisite knowledge in players registration, renewal of players registration and also loaning in and out of players.

The Training Exercise started for a while now with several Municipals/Districts covered including Yendi Municipal, Salaga District, Bole District, West Mamprusi, Nanumba District, STK district, to mention but few.

It was now the turn of Sagnarigu Municipal and Tamale Metro to benefit from the NRFA Chairman’s special initiative on Wednesday, 28th October, 2020 at the Aliu Mahama Stadium. The turn out for the training was massive. Participants were taking through theory by the RFA Secretary, Abdul-Karim Abdul-Gafaru and the practical session was handled by Abubakari Yussif, popularly known as Van Der Sar.

All the members of the Statistics and Data committee were present to monitor proceedings including the Chairman of the committee, Mr Mohammed Nurudeen Sham-Una. Everything went on smoothly.

Meanwhile, the players transfer window will close on Saturday, 31st October, 2020.
